1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a radical in mathematics?
Back
A radical is a symbol used to represent the root of a number, most commonly the square root. For example, √4 represents the square root of 4.

2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you multiply two radicals?
Back
To multiply two radicals, you multiply the numbers inside the radicals together and then take the square root of the product. For example, √a * √b = √(a*b).
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the product property of square roots?
Back
The product property states that the square root of a product is equal to the product of the square roots: √(a*b) = √a * √b.

4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the quotient property of square roots?
Back
The quotient property states that the square root of a quotient is equal to the quotient of the square roots: √(a/b) = √a / √b.

5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you simplify a radical expression?
Back
To simplify a radical expression, factor the number under the radical into its prime factors and look for pairs of factors. Each pair can be taken out of the radical.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does it mean to rationalize the denominator?
Back
Rationalizing the denominator means to eliminate any radicals from the denominator of a fraction by multiplying the numerator and denominator by a suitable radical.
